Catherine Anne Leone, known professionally as Leather Leone, is an American heavy metal vocalist, best known for fronting the groups Rude Girl and Chastain in the 1980s. She released one solo album, Shock Waves, in 1989, before taking a twenty-year break from the music scene.[1] In 2011 she began performing again in The Sledge/Leather Project, which released a debut heavy metal album, Imagine Me Alive, in 2012.

Solo albums and Sledge/Leather
Leone released her debut solo album, Shock Waves, in 1989 on Roadrunner Records. The album was first released in 1989 through David T. Chastain's own label Leviathan Records.[1] After a final tour in 1991, she disappeared from the music scene.[2]
Leone resurfaced in 2011 to form the duo The Sledge/Leather Project with former bandmate Sandy Sledge on drums, and Matthias 'Matthew' Weisheit on guitar. The heavy metal duo released a debut album, Imagine Me Alive, in early 2012.[2]
Leone has recently resurfaced with a band in Brasil. In 2016, 2018, and 2019, she did a South American and European tours with much success.
